Output 65598a8c533cc2cce23d4dd0ba865e62c4cf072c86440b964d6d3d2eb4d923f7:1

value
2624640
script pubkey
OP_0 OP_PUSHBYTES_20 8e3daa18fc6b304f476f64633ea332333410d8f6
address
ltc1q3c765x8udvcy73m0v33nagejxv6ppk8kc58k47
transaction
65598a8c533cc2cce23d4dd0ba865e62c4cf072c86440b964d6d3d2eb4d923f7
spent
true